Township of Millburn v. Palardy
Petition for certiorari denied on May 13, 2019
Issue: Whether, and how, the Supreme Court"s two-step framework for evaluating First Amendment retaliation claims by public employees applies to a claim alleging retaliation based on an employee"s association with a public-sector union.
